Montpelier Arts Center celebrates Women's History Month with a free panel discussion, “Building Community” moderated by WPFW’s Katea Stitt. Professional musicians, community leaders, teachers, parents, students and jazz fans of any gender will have an opportunity to look behind the scenes to see how festivals and concert series have been mounted by leading female artists. They’ll get a realistic look at some of the challenges those women faced in developing successful community-backed events.

Moderator Katea Stitt is acting program director D.C. radio station WPFW. Three acclaimed artists will serve on the panel. Amy K. Bormet, currently living in Los Angeles, is an in-demand pianist, vocalist, and composer. She created the Washington Women in Jazz Festival in 2011 and serves as executive director. DC Trombonist Jennifer Krupa is a member of the U. S. Navy Band Commodores Jazz Ensemble since 2004, Krupa also performs regularly with the Smithsonian Jazz Masterworks Orchestra, The DIVA Jazz Orchestra, and her own group, the Jen Krupa-Leigh Pilzer Quintet.
